OBS not consistently connecting to camera on first try

We have three cameras with each connected to AverMedia Mini Capture Cards which in turn connect to our live streaming computer. Each is set up in OBS as a video capture device using the appropriate AverMedia Mini Capture Cards as the input device. A few months ago, our Panasonic camera intermittently would not show any output in any of the scenes in which it was used. If we recycle OBS, it typically would then show up after one or more recycles of OBS. If recycling OBS a number of tries does not work, we would recycle windows. In may show up in OBS on the first try or after a few more recycling of OBS. Due to only having 3 USB ports we are using two USB hubs as described in Setup below. It was working consistently with these hubs but then a few months ago we started getting the situation describe above. We are currently running 29.1.1. We did delete the Video Capture Source for the Panasonic Camera and re-added with the same results. We normally turn on the cameras first, then turn on the computer and OBS. Turning the cameras on after the computer and OBS still has the same issue. It was awhile back when this started happening. We were probably on 27.x or 28.x. I don’t recall it happening right after we did an OBS or Windows update but it could have.

Equipment Setup

USB Hub 3.1 connects to computer USB 3.1 port
Panasonic Video Camera connects to AverMedia Mini Capture Card which connects to USB Hub 3.1
Canon Video Camera connects to AverMedia Mini Capture Card which connects to USB Hub 3.1

Canon Video Camera connects to AverMedia Mini Capture Card which connects to computer USB 3.1

USB Hub 2.0 connects to computer USB 2.0 port
Soundboard connects to Scarlet Solo Audio Interface which connects to USB Hub 2.0
Wireless mouse connects to USB Hub 2.0
